Recruitment Fraud Alert

We have become aware of an increase in fraudulent recruitment activities in which individuals impersonate our company or authorized recruitment agencies to offer fake employment opportunities. These scams may occur through false websites, emails, social media, or chat-based applications and often aim to obtain personal information or money. Please note that Hewlett Packard Enterprise (HPE), its direct and indirect subsidiaries and affiliated companies, and its authorized recruitment agencies/vendors will never charge a candidate a registration fee, hiring fee, or any other fee in connection with its recruitment and hiring process. We also never request personal information such as back account details, Social Security numbers, or national IDs via social media or chat applications.

All legitimate job opportunities will come through official company channels, and candidates are responsible for verifying the credentials of any third party claiming to represent the company. Any reliance on fraudulent communication is at the individual’s own risk, and HPE disclaims legal liability for any resulting damages. If you suspect recruitment fraud, do not share personal information or make any payments and report the incident to your local authorities immediately.

In 1939, Bill Hewlett and Dave Packard, college friends turned business partners, started the original Silicon Valley startup in the space of a rented Palo Alto garage. Starting with audio oscillators, the friends built the foundation for a company that would grow to become a global leader in enterprise technology. More than 75 years later, our success is exemplified through our employees’ drive to advance ideas that bring meaningful innovations to life for our customers and partners around the globe.
